About Katha
KATHA, since 1988, has been a unique model that seamlessly connects grassroots work in education, translation, urban resurgence, & story. KATHA has the following key components - KREAD (Katha Relevant Education For All-Round Development), SPICE (social, personal, intellectual, cultural & environmental) promotes growth in children, Vidduniya - integrated classroom learning to understand the seamless connection between subjects, and story pedagogy, use of stories to engage children to think, ask, discuss & act instead of using of textbooks. KATHA tool kit-training of teachers by the use of various teaching tools to engage children & make learning a fun experience through music, dance, theatre, discussion, debate, and surveys.
